Fig. 1: NO depletion with c-PTIO abolishes the capacity of breast cancer cells to form mammospheres in vitro.

From: Nitric oxide-targeted therapy inhibits stemness and increases the efficacy of tamoxifen in estrogen receptor-positive breast cancer cells

Fig. 1

a Representative images and percentage of mammospheres formed after 2 weeks of seeding MCF-7 cells pre-treated during 24 h with the indicated doses of c-PTIO. b Immunoblot of Notch-1 in nuclear fractions of MCF-7 cells. Cells were treated with different concentrations of c-PTIO for 24 h and Notch-1 was detected using a specific antibody. Transcription factor II-B (TFIIB) was used as loading control. c Representative images and mammospheres percentage formed from MCF-7, MDA-MB-361 and BT-474 cells pre-treated for 24 h with c-PTIO (100 μM), in the absence or the presence of the NO-donor DETANONOate (100 μM). Scale bars: 50 μm. Data are means ± SEM of three independent experiments (*p < 0.05; **p < 0.01; ***p < 0.001 compared with control).
